Offer description

The Role Working in STōK Cae Ras on match days and events, you’ll be reporting into our Hospitality Supervisors, ensuring that all our customers have an enjoyable and memorable experience. Main Responsibilities: Matchday Receptionist/Front of House Be a warm and welcoming presence on a matchday (or other events) when people arrive for their hospitality experience Scan tickets as appropriate Ensure an exceptional standard of service to all customers Deal with customer requests and queries efficiently. Abide by and enforce all licensing laws including Challenge 25. Attend mandatory and other training as required including online training. Other duties as required. Bar staff Preparing the bar areas for service and assist in keeping the bar and front of house area clean and tidy. Preparing requested drinks orders made by other members of the team. Taking orders and serving drinks and occasionally food to customers. Ensure an exceptional standard of service to all customers. Deal with customer requests and queries efficiently. Stock control and rotation throughout service including stock transfers and waste. Operating tills and the use of hand-held ordering systems. Abide by and enforce all licensing laws including Challenge 25. Attend mandatory and other training as required including online training. Other duties as required. Hospitality Staff Working in the Club Hospitality areas, serving food and beverage (including alcohol) items to our guests. Maintain a fast-paced service experience before and throughout the football match/ event. Maintain a clean, neat, and tidy working area throughout every shift. Take instruction from senior team members to ensure proper stock management/rotation and replenishment. Provide excellent customer service to our visitors, providing full product knowledge of our menu that is on offer. Operating tills and the use of hand-held ordering systems. Attend mandatory and other training as required including online training. Other duties as required.
